Brooksville residents and visitors will soon have the opportunity to view the works of artist James Oleson at Boyette’s Grove and Citrus Attraction. The classic Florida roadside attraction, a long-standing fixture on Florida's Adventure Coast, is preparing to host an art gallery showcasing Oleson's pieces.
Boyette's Grove, located at 6715 US-301 in Hernando County, has been a local landmark for generations, known for its unique blend of citrus, gifts, and quirky charm that echoes the rural heritage of the Brooksville area. The addition of an art gallery featuring a local or regional artist like James Oleson is expected to draw interest from the community and further enhance the attraction's appeal.
Details regarding the specific dates of the exhibition, a potential opening reception, and the types of works to be displayed have not yet been released.
